Chapter 3. Menu Features

General Guidelines to MENU Access and Settings

1.Press Soft Key 1Menu . The three menu items will appear on the display screen.

2.Press , , or to go through the list of menu features.

3.Press the corresponding number to the menu item you want to select. Then the sub-menu list will appear on the screen.

4.Press the appropriate key to select the sub-menu you want to access.

5.Select preferred settings, using , , or . Press Soft Key 2 Back to go one step backward

while accessing menu or selecting settings.

6.Press Soft Key 1 Ok to save the settings or Soft Key 2 Back to cancel without saving.

Sound (Menu )

Ring Sound (Menu )

Press Soft Key 1 Menu . Press Sound, then select

Ring Sound. Press , , or until you find the sound you desire. Then press Soft Key 1 Ok to save the ring sound.

Ring Type (Menu )

Select one of four ring types (Ring, Vibrate, Vib+ Ring,

and Lamp) with , , or .

Key Tone (Menu )

Set Key Tone length and touch tone playback speed.

Normal: Sends out a tone for a fixed period of time.

Long: Sends out a continuous tone for as long as you keep the key pressed.

Use the volume buttons on the side of the phone to increase and decrease the volume.
